Moonshot and ZAI now produce models whose results on website generation sit close enough to OpenAI and Anthropic systems that buyers focused on acceptable output can switch for a 75 percent lower price than Claude.
Context
The Bloomberg report centers on one narrow capability: the ability to generate passable websites. Until the appearance of these Chinese models, the two American labs set the visible price floor for that class of work. The new data removes most of that premium on this specific task while leaving every other dimension—speed, context length, safety filters, or uptime—unaddressed in the published account.
The shift matters first to teams that already treat model output as a starting point rather than a finished product. Those teams can test an alternative endpoint at one-quarter the previous cost and decide whether the quality difference justifies the higher spend. The report supplies no side-by-side examples, no token pricing tables, and no information on how the models behave outside website-building prompts.
Detail
The sole quantitative claim is the 75 percent discount relative to Claude for equivalent website work. No model sizes, training methods, release dates, or benchmark tables appear in the account. The comparison is limited to the stated task and does not extend to coding, reasoning chains, or agent workflows.
Because the source supplies only this single data point, any broader ranking of the four labs remains unsupported. Readers therefore cannot determine whether Moonshot and ZAI match the leaders on other commercial uses or merely on the narrow slice the report examined.
Why it matters
Engineering groups that route routine page generation through paid APIs now face a straightforward arithmetic decision. At one-quarter the cost, a project that previously consumed a fixed monthly budget can either run four times as many prompts or redirect the savings elsewhere. The calculation is most attractive for teams whose internal review already catches and corrects the shortcomings of “passable” output.
Larger organizations that operate under data-residency or procurement rules will still need to clear the new providers through legal and security reviews before any volume shift occurs. The Bloomberg account does not discuss export controls, logging practices, or contract terms, so those teams cannot yet treat the price advantage as immediately usable.
For individual developers and small startups, the lower price removes the main remaining barrier to experimentation. A founder who once kept prompts short to stay under budget can now run longer or more frequent trials without the same constraint. Over time, that volume increase may surface failure modes the current report does not capture.
The narrow but concrete result is that the price premium once commanded by the leading labs has shrunk sharply on at least one visible commercial task. Buyers who accept the quality trade-off can act on that fact today; everyone else must wait for additional data on the dimensions the report left untouched.
